Kaffaga, et al. v. Steinbeck, et al.
Plaintiff: WAVERLY SCOTT KAFFAGA, as Executor of The Estate of Elaine Anderson Steinbeck and BAHAR KAFFAGA, as Executor of The Estate of Elaine Anderson Steinbeck
Defendant: GAIL KNIGHT STEINBECK, THOMAS STEINBECK and PALLADIN GROUP INC.
Case Number: 25-2497
Filed: April 17, 2025
Court: U.S.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it
Nature of Suit: Other
